Oliver Ashmore is a creative from Yorkshire, currently completing a BA (Hons) in Photography at Manchester Metropolitan University. Over the past five years, he has explored a wide range of creative disciplines, including photography, videography, magazine editing, and graphic design.

His journey has taken him across various levels of the creative industry, working with renowned artists such as Chase & Status, Becky Hill, and Crucast, and capturing major festivals like Truck Festival, Bassfest, Parklife, El Dorado, Wacken Open Air, and MDL Beast Soundstorm. Oliver has collaborated with leading companies including Lab54, Tagmix, and The Warehouse Project, specializing in high-engagement, viral content.

Passionate about storytelling, music, and visual artistry, Oliver strives to blend these elements into compelling imagery and dynamic content. Through his work in photography he aims to create projects that resonate with audiences, elevate brands, and bring the energy of live events to life.
